When meaninglessness spreads into your mental sense of being, your alarm bell goes off. Unchecked, the poison of meaninglessness will paralyze you, torture you, and no gimmicks will do. Fortunately, Hatred is ready on your shelf. A good hatred target will get your blood boiling, will focus your action, will inject plenty of meaning and purpose into your veins -- meaninglessness defeated.


Like many vaccines, hatred, handy as it is, it comes with very serious side effects. It is a poison on its own. It kills the garden of life, it invokes hatred in return, it locks you, it blinds you. It is a very easy antidot, but a very bad one against meaninglessness -- try Religion21! Innovate!
